Content-only edits to test.cpp to remove Ruby-only syntax that has no
C++ ECMAScript equivalent:
1. Removed: "a{,8}" — Ruby-only "{,n}" no-lower-bound quantifier
(ECMAScript requires an explicit lower bound in {n,m})
2. Removed: second ".*" for /.*/m — mode flags in C++ are construction-site
arguments (e.g. std::regex::multiline), not part of the pattern string.
This mode variant was the exact same pattern string as r_meta1 so it
added no coverage.
3. Removed: "(?'foo'fo+)" — Ruby single-quote named-group form.
ECMAScript only supports the angle-bracket form (?<name>...).
Left in place for now (removed with the parser in commit 5):
\\A, \\z, \\G, \\h, \\H — Ruby-only anchor/escape classes.
The POSIX-bracket cases are kept through commit 7.

C/C++ CodeQL tests
This document provides additional information about the C/C++ CodeQL tests located in cpp/ql/test. The principles under "Copying code", below, also apply to any other C/C++ code in this repository, such as examples linked from query .qhelp files in cpp/ql/src. For more general information about contributing to this repository, see Contributing to CodeQL.
The tests can be run through Visual Studio Code. Advanced users may also use the codeql test run command.
Contributing to the tests
We are keen to have unit tests for all of our QL code.
Every query in cpp/ql/src (outside of cpp/ql/src/experimental) should have a test in the corresponding subdirectory of cpp/ql/test/query-tests. At a minimum, each query test should contain one case that should be detected by the query, and one related case that should not.
For example a simple test for the "Memory is never freed" (cpp/memory-never-freed) query might contain the following cases:
int *array1, *array2;
array1 = (int *)malloc(sizeof(int) * 100); // BAD: never freed
array2 = (int *)malloc(sizeof(int) * 100); // GOOD
free(array2);
Features of the QL libraries in cpp/ql/src should also have test coverage, in cpp/ql/test/library-tests.
Copying code
The contents of cpp/ql/test should be original - nothing should be copied from other sources. In particular do not copy-paste C/C++ code from third-party projects, your own projects, or the standard C/C++ library implementation of your compiler (regardless of the associated license). As an exception, required declarations may be taken from the following sources where necessary:
- ISO/IEC Programming languages - C (all versions)
- ISO/IEC Programming languages - C++ (all versions)
- Code from existing queries and tests in this repository. This includes 'translating QL to C++', that is, writing C/C++ declarations from the information such as parameter names and positions specified in QL classes (when there is enough information to do so).
- Code in the public domain
For example the test above for the "Memory is never freed" (cpp/memory-never-freed) query requires the following declarations, taken from ISO/IEC 9899:2018 - Programming languages - C:
void *malloc(size_t size);
void free(void *ptr);
We also need to write our own definition of size_t. Any unsigned integral type will do for our purposes:
typedef unsigned int size_t;
Including files
Standard and third-party library header files should not be included in tests by means of #include or similar mechanisms. This is because the tests should be independent of platform and library versions installed on the running machine. Standard library declarations may be inserted directly where necessary (see the rules in the section above), but it is generally better to avoid using the standard library at all when possible.
#include may be used to include files from the same directory within cpp/ql/test. For example the test for "Include header files only" (cpp/include-non-header) includes other files in the test directory:
#include "test.H"
#include "test.xpm"
#include "test2.c"
